Tamil geographies : cultural constructions of space and place in South India

Bibliographic Information

Tamil geographies : cultural constructions of space and place in South India

edited by Martha Ann Selby, Indira Viswanathan Peterson

(SUNY series in Hindu studies)

State University of New York Press, c2008

Contents of Works

  • Dialogues of space, desire, and gender in Tamil caṅkam poetry / Martha Ann Selby
  • Four spatial realms in Tirukkōvaiyār / Norman J. Cutler
  • The drama of the Kur̲avañci fortune-teller : land, landscape, and social relations in an eighteenth-century Tamil genre / Indira Viswanathan Peterson
  • Ruling in the gaze of God : thoughts on Kanchipuram's maṇḍala / D. Dennis Hudson
  • Cosmos, realm, and property in early medieval South India / Daud Ali
  • Sanctum and gopuram at Madurai : aesthetics of akam and pur̲am in Tamil temple architecture / Samuel K. Parker
  • From wasteland to bus stand : the relocation of demons in Tamilnadu / Isabelle Clark-Decès
  • Waiting for Veḷḷāḷakaṇṭan̲ : narrative, movement, and making place in a Tamil village / Diane P. Mines
  • Permeable homes : domestic service, household space, and the vulnerability of class boundaries in urban South India / Sara Dickey
  • Gender plays : socio-spatial paradigms on the Tamil popular stage / Susan Seizer
